Part oneMacbeth is the last of the four tragedies written by Shakespeare and it is also " the most frightening one" said by Bradley. It is just in the frightening atmosphere that Shakespeare depicted Macbeth, who was once a powerful hero, was reduced to a tyrant bringing calamity to the country and the people, which reflected individual ambition and power and lust will destroy human nature and which also show us the nature of anti-humanity caused by extreme individualism.However, as a careerist, why could Macbeth be the protagonist of the tragedy and inspire pity and terror in the audience? This is a difficult question Shakespeare was confronted with. It is also a theoretical problem that the researchers of all times were confronted with. According to this thesis, the reason that Macbeth can be main character of tragedy is not only because of the explanation of Bradley, but also because of his wife's instigation and incitement, the witch and the influence of the prophecy and the dark, bloody and evil atmosphere that envelop the whole play. Admittedly, Macbeth is different from the tragedy of the old Greece, for his doom is his own fault. The evils made him go further on the road of offence. The existing evils more or less relieve the audience's feelings of his being destroyed. This thesis is going to deal with the aesthetic problem and discuss the character of Macbeth and his wife, the effects of witch and the prophecy on the tragedy, and the dark, bloody and evil atmosphere that envelop the play. In the discussion, we will refer to the advantages of the analysis of human's characters and imagery to grasp the ideological connotation and the aesthetic features of the tragedy.Part twoThe fact that a celebrated hero, down to a fierce tyrant, was an artistic summary of all kinds of adventurers, carreists of Renaissance by Shakespeare. However, the characters of Macbeth are extremely complex. Though he was down to a tyrant who brought calamity to the country and the people, he still was different from those inborn bastards and mean villains. His tremendous talents and outstanding spirit manifest his road to offence as a hero who coveted the throne. Moreover, while Shakespeare was exploring his guilt, he also portrayed that he was in great torment.Just as Bradley indicated that Macbeth had an imagination like a poet, which was one of the characteristics of Macbeth. However, we must realize that his imagination is always gloomy, terrible, bloody, vicious and indifferent to those good things of life. Therefore, his imagination can't subdue his increasing ambition and his uncontrollable evil acts. In this sense, his imagination is his worst point in his character, by means of which, he relieved himself of self-condemnation. Shakespeare depicted the vanishing human nature on the one hand, and the tragic struggle of the corrupting human nature on the other hand. Meanwhile, Shakespeare went further into the extreme individualism which brought calamity to the country and the people and which also meant the psychological death of Macbeth .As long as before his death, he had lost his belief in life , and died psychologically . The understanding of his doom strengthened the tragedy of his condition.Part threeMacbeth's wife is the most ruthless and frightening woman under the pen of Shakespeare. She is the typical careerist and adventurer of Renaissance like Macbeth. However, she is different from Macbeth. She is more resolute, more arbitrary and more regardless of conscientiousness and emotions. But her character is not unchanged, but evolving with the plot.From the day when she knew the witch's prophecy, she was burning with fanatical ambition and didn't consider the danger and consequence of killing. She turned things upside down and her words were flooded with sophistry and error .She was hard-hearted and vicious and her instigation and incitement resulted in Macbeth's offence.
